Friends who love flowers and plants, and are looking for various affordable flowers, especially cut flowers, there is one place you must not miss: Taipei Flower Market in Neihu. Taipei's flower market can be traced back to its early days at the head of Taipei Bridge, and has gone through various locations such as Jiuquan Street Wanhe Temple and Binjiang Flower Market. Because it serves both wholesale and retail, it is the source of goods for all flower shops in Taipei, so there is nothing it doesn't have. In this flower market, you can not only admire various flowers, but also often find affordable flowers here. Taipei Flower Market is divided into two halls, A and B. The first floor of Hall A has cut flower stalls, selling various flowers such as baby's breath, green carnations, chrysanthemums, and lilies. The second floor has material stalls, offering flower baskets, potted plants, decorative flowers, gardening tools, etc. The first floor of Hall B has potted plant stalls, selling various potted plants such as succulents, foliage plants, and orchids, and has a parking lot for the convenience of shoppers. The Taipei Flower Market in Neihu is the opposite of the weekend flower market in that its business hours are during regular working hours, from early morning to noon. Therefore, people who want to visit the flower market on weekends should pay attention to the business hours.
